It’s not a perfect world for sure. But I’m pretty sure I would not be with current financial conditions if I had stayed in Portugal. Also I’m able to work less hours per day and move away from consulting companies which, at the time, seemed to be the only ones hiring in the IT world. Not sure if I call it “Housing crisis” to be honest. Depends on the definition of “crisis”. Prices have increased significantly in the last years? Yes but same applies across Europe. a crisis typically ends at some point. I don’t believe these prices will ever go down across Europe not just Ireland/Dublin. In Portugal everyone also complains about housing prices. Do you prefer paying 1500€ for rent and get 3000€ per month or 1000€ and get 1500€? In general, Dublin doesn’t cost double as Lisbon and typically you can get double or more the salary here. Supermarket costs the same between Lisbon and Dublin to be honest. Weather is shit and food isn’t the same either. And yes I’m away from family and childhood friends which has its toll as well but I’m happier. I can do the things I want including saving a good amount of money without constraining myself to what I do.

Portugal has a payment system called Multibanco created by a company called SIBS (also Portuguese). It’s a great system to be honest. All countries would benefit from a system like this.
